Title of article :
Multiplicity of periodic solutions for a delayed ratio-dependent predator-prey model with Holling type III functional response and harvesting terms

Abstract :
By using the generalized continuation theorem, the existence of four positive periodic solutions for a delayed ratio-dependent predator-prey model with Holling type III functional response { x ′ ( t ) = x ( t ) [ a ( t ) − b ( t ) x ( t ) ] − c ( t ) x 2 ( t ) y ( t ) m 2 y 2 ( t ) + x 2 ( t ) − h 1 ( t ) , y ′ ( t ) = y ( t ) [ e ( t ) x 2 ( t − τ ( t ) ) m 2 y 2 ( t − τ ( t ) ) + x 2 ( t − τ ( t ) ) − d ( t ) ] − h 2 ( t ) , is established, where a ( t ) , b ( t ) , c ( t ) , e ( t ) , d ( t ) , τ ( t ) , h 1 ( t ) and h 2 ( t ) are all nonnegative periodic continuous functions with period ω > 0 , m > 0 is a constant. Our main result also improves some well-known results obtained before, especially when h 1 ( t ) = h 2 ( t ) ≡ 0 , the conditions that guarantee the existence of four positive periodic solutions reduce exactly to that of a previous conclusion.
